The Million Mark Bank Note designed by Herbert Bayer (Bauhaus) commissioned by the Thuringian Mint in 1923.
At the start of the famous "Art and Technology;A New Unity",Bauhaus exhibit ( August 15 - September 30,1923), the dollar was worth two million marks.
By the end,a dollar was worth 160 million marks.
